Cod sursa(job #1455353)

Utilizator petru.cehanCehan Petru petru.cehan Data 27 iunie 2015 18:09:00
Problema Combinari Scor 80
Compilator cpp Status done
Runda Arhiva educationala Marime 0.55 kb
#include <iostream>
#include <fstream>

using namespace std;

ifstream fin ("combinari.in");
ofstream fout ("combinari.out");

int sol[18] , n , m ;

void Afisare ()
{
    int i;
    for ( i = 1 ; i <= m ; ++ i )
          fout << sol [i] << " ";
    fout << endl ;
}

void Back (int k)
{
    int i ;
    if ( k == m + 1 )
           Afisare();
    else
    for ( i = sol[k-1] + 1 ; i <= n - m + k ; ++ i )
    {
        sol [k] = i ;
        Back (k+1) ;
    }
}
int main()
{
    fin >> n >> m ;
    Back (1);
    return 0;
}